Output 17c3222a42a2a0838d6e69d710964bc86e603d4ba484c1669b626f8d9d463031:1

value
19285261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9392a5042fef6e19d40ba0bce6c0681a640d11c8 OP_EQUAL
address
3F9JvnepgcuGNrEcknJdu8oNQPo2UjeVZv
transaction
17c3222a42a2a0838d6e69d710964bc86e603d4ba484c1669b626f8d9d463031
spent
true